> Hi,
> I'm using servicemix 3.2-incubating-SNAPSHOT and quite recent ApacheODE
> (revision 561322). I need to pass through the whole flow the authentication
> details. The flow is quite simple, I have a Bpel endpoint called by
> ServiceMix, then bpel invokes couple of ServiceMix endpoints. All this is
> done in one bpel process. In ServiceMix I created own JmsConsumerMarshaller
> that attaches the SecuritySubject to the NormalizedMessage. I see that ODE
> does not copy the SecuritySubject and eventually when ODE process invokes
> ServiceMix the SecuritySubject is lost. I looked to the ODE code and it
> happens in OdeService in the invokeOde method when incoming normalized
> request is converted to ode internal request (mapper.toODE(odeRequest,
> request, msgdef);). Would it be possible to store the Security info in a kind
> of a context so that when OdeConsumer invokes partners the SecuritySubject is
> attached to the NormalizedMessage sent to ServiceMix ?
